Understanding Digital Marketing and Campaigns
Before delving into the power of influencer marketing, it is essential to understand the dynamics of digital marketing and digital campaigns. Digital marketing encompasses a wide array of promotional efforts that leverage electronic devices and the internet. From social media marketing and email marketing to search engine optimization (SEO) and beyond, digital marketing offers a plethora of tools and techniques to engage audiences online.
Digital campaigns, on the other hand, are meticulously structured, goal-oriented strategies that employ various digital marketing channels to achieve specific objectives, such as increasing brand awareness, driving website traffic, generating leads, or boosting sales. These campaigns are designed to target the right audience and often revolve around captivating content to seize attention in the competitive digital space.
The Rise of Influencer Marketing
Influencer marketing, a relatively new yet highly impactful aspect of digital marketing, has taken the industry by storm. Influencers are individuals with a substantial following on social media platforms, blogs, or other online channels. They have established a loyal audience by creating authentic and engaging content that deeply resonates with their followers.
The core principle of influencer marketing lies in the power of trust and relatability. Influencers have positioned themselves as authorities in their respective niches, making their recommendations and endorsements highly influential among their followers. Brands have quickly recognized that partnering with these influencers can be a potent strategy to amplify their digital campaigns and reach a broader, relevant audience.
The Impact of Influencer Marketing on Digital Campaigns
1. Increased Reach and Visibility
Collaborating with influencers exposes your brand to their extensive follower base, exponentially expanding your campaign’s reach and visibility. This strategic move puts your brand in front of potential customers who might not have encountered it otherwise.
2. Authenticity and Trust
Influencers thrive on authenticity, fostering trust among their followers. When an influencer speaks positively about your brand, their audience is more likely to trust the endorsement, significantly boosting credibility for your products or services.
3.Targeted Audience Segmentation
Influencers often have a specific niche or demographic they cater to. Partnering with the right influencer enables precise audience segmentation, ensuring that your digital campaign reaches the people who are genuinely interested in your offerings.
4. Engaging Content Creation
Influencers are natural content creators. When they collaborate with your brand, they can produce compelling and creative content that seamlessly integrates your products or services, captivating the attention of their followers.
5. Boosted Conversions and Sales
As a result of the trust and credibility built by influencers, their endorsements can profoundly impact purchasing decisions. Influencer marketing has proven to boost conversions and drive sales for many brands.
Key Tips for Successful Influencer Marketing Campaigns
1. Relevance Matters
Choose influencers whose niche aligns with your brand and campaign objectives. Relevance ensures that the audience is genuinely interested in what you offer.
2. Build Genuine Relationships
Prioritize building authentic relationships with influencers rather than treating them as mere marketing tools. Strong partnerships lead to more compelling campaigns.
3. Quality over Quantity
Focus on collaborating with influencers who have a genuinely engaged audience, rather than solely chasing high follower counts.
4. Track and Analyze Performance
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) of your influencer marketing campaigns to measure their effectiveness and make data-driven decisions for future campaigns.
